Handover note for the dispatch desk: the sealed exam papers for the Ravenmoor assessment are packed in a single grey pouch with two intact seals, verified by me at 08:10. Please keep the pouch in the locked drawer until the booked courier arrives, and record the seal numbers on the outbound log before release. The confidential hand-over instruction for the courier is given immediately below.

handover note for tajeg-kadup: the pelox gilok courier leaves the norwyn ledger at gate 7313 under passcode 004897

Q: Health checks pass but Greywharf nodes get pulled from the balancer?

A: The Lintbridge balancer uses the deep check on /status/full, not the shallow one you're curling. Deep check fails when the session store is sealed after a restart. Unseal it from the node's recovery shell, then checks go green within a minute. Unseal using the passphrase below.

vault phrase of kafog-kahif = holdor-rusir-praox

Escalation: DeployDrone chat bot. If DeployDrone stops posting deploy status to the release channel, first check the Quillhaven webhook relay dashboard for dropped events. A restart of the `drone-courier` service usually recovers it within two minutes. If status messages are wrong rather than missing, that's a pipeline metadata issue — do not restart anything. In either case, if the problem lasts past 15 minutes, email the bot maintainers.

alerts address for bajop-yahog: istwyn@lumiclabs.internal

Handover note — Crumbwheel order cutoffs.

Welcome aboard. The bakery cutoff rule in Crumbwheel closes same-day orders at 14:00 local to each storefront, not UTC — this has bitten us twice. Holiday overrides live in the calendar service and take precedence silently, so always check there first when a cutoff looks wrong. To unlock the calendar service's admin console after a restart, enter the recovery passphrase below.

vault phrase of bagap-bahaf = silion-pelox-sorox-casdor-quenwyn-fraax-eliox-praael-kelion-quenvan-kasox-rusael-norius-belvan